Latest Patents

Among Peter's latest innovations is a sophisticated method of controlling a solenoid actuated fuel injector. This method involves a solenoid actuator that manipulates a pintle and needle arrangement, allowing the needle to transit from a closed valve seat to an open position. Central to this innovation is the incorporation of circuitry that applies chopped hysteresis control after an initial energization phase. The steps outlined include recognizing a signal of current or voltage across the solenoid, analyzing this signal to detect a chopped hysteresis pulse, determining when this pulse concludes, and subsequently applying a braking pulse dependent on this timing.

Another recent patent by Peter elaborates on an advanced method of operating a solenoid activated fuel injector. This process focuses on measuring the voltage or current during the valve closure phase following its opening. From these measurements, parameters vital for adjusting the activation pulse profile during future fueling cycles of the injector can be derived, allowing for more precise control of the fuel injection process.
